摘 要:目的探讨微小RNA-429(miR-429)过表达对乳腺癌细胞增殖及侵袭的影响,并分析其与Wnt信号通路的可能作用机制。方法选取2017年8月至2018年6月手术治疗的76例乳腺癌患者,切除癌组织及癌旁组织作为乳腺癌组与癌旁组,采用实时定量聚合酶链反应(qRT-PCR)检测2组miR-429表达水平。体外培养乳腺癌细胞株MCF-7,采用脂质体Lipofectamin 2000介导的方法转染细胞,分为空白对照组、阴性转染组以及miR-429 mimics组,倒置荧光显微镜下检测转染效率,qRT-PCR法检测3组细胞中miR-429表达水平;MTT法及平板克隆形成实验检测细胞增殖能力;Transwell法检测细胞侵袭能力;蛋白免疫印迹法(WB)检测ki67、基质金属蛋白酶-2(MMP-2)、基质金属蛋白酶-9(MMP-9)、细胞核β-链蛋白(β-catenin)及Wnt通路相关蛋白表达情况。结果与癌旁组相比,乳腺癌组组织中miR-429表达水平明显降低(P<0.05);与空白对照组和阴性转染组相比,miR-429 mimics组的miR-429表达水平、细胞增殖抑制率显著升高,细胞克隆形成率、细胞侵袭数量及ki67、MMP-2、MMP-9、Wnt、GSK-3β、β-Catenin表达水平均显著降低,差异有统计学意义(P<0.05)。结论miR-429过表达可抑制乳腺癌细胞增殖及侵袭,其作用机制可能与抑制Wnt信号通路有关。Objective To investigate the effects of overexpression of microRNA-429(microRNA-429)on the proliferation and invasion of breast cancer cells,and to analyze its possible action mechanism in Wnt signaling pathway.Methods Ninety-seven patients with breast cancer who underwent surgical treatment in our hospital from August 2017 to June 2018 were enrolled as research subjects.The specimens of resected breast cancer tissues anf para-cancerous tissues were taken as breast cancer group and para-cancerous tissues group,respectively.The expression levels of microRNA-429 were detected by real-time quantitative polymerase chain reaction(qPCR).And MCF-7 cells were cultured in vitro and divided into control group,negative control group and microRNA-429 mimics group.The transfection efficiency was detected by inverted fluorescence microscopy,the expression levels of microRNA-429 were detected by qRT-PCR,and the proliferation ability of breast cancer cells was detected by MTT and plate cloning assay,and the invasive ability of cells was detected by Transwell method.Moreover the expression levels of Ki67,MMP-2,MMP-9,β-catenin and Wnt pathway related proteins were detected by Western Blot(WB).Results As compared with those in para-cancerous tissues group,the expression levels of microRNA-429 in breast cancer tissue group were significantly decreased(P<0.05).As compared with those in blank control group and negative transfection group,the expression levels of microRNA-429 and the inhibition rate of cell proliferation in overexpression of microRNA-429 group were significantly increased(P<0.05).Moreover the cell cloning rate,the number of cell invasion and the expression levels of ki67,MMP-2,MMP-9,Wnt,GSK-3beta and beta-Catenin were significantly decreased(P<0.05).Conclusion The overexpression of miR-429 can inhibit the proliferation,migration,and invasion of breast cancer cells,and its action mechanism may be related to the inhibition of Wnt signaling pathway.
